The Hague (Den Haag) suits travellers who want museums, government architecture or a North Sea beach at Scheveningen rather than windmills or a compact historic town alone. It needs a clearer time budget than a short Rotterdam city loop and should be planned as a dedicated regional focus.

Transfer time from the Rotterdam area is commonly on the order of half an hour or more each way by road or train, before pier connections — verify live options for your date and do not cut the return fine.

City highlights and Scheveningen pull in different directions; pick one primary interest so the day does not dissolve into transit.

The Hague is a strong private-tour candidate when your party has specific museum or coastal goals and a long enough call.

First-time visitors who only want a single ‘classic Holland’ snapshot often find Kinderdijk or Delft a clearer single-story day.

The Hague from Rotterdam — FAQs

Is The Hague worth it on a short cruise call?

Usually not. Short calls favour Rotterdam city and harbour. Save The Hague for longer windows with a clear reason to go.

How does The Hague compare with Delft?

Delft is more compact and historic-town focused; The Hague is a larger city with museums and a coast option. Delft is often simpler to enjoy in a half-day.
